York is without doubt the home of chocolate in England and here the story of chocolate becomes an experience for the senses. Our guide, the amazing Amy, took us through the background of Rowentree and Terry chocolates, back into the origins of chocolate in Mexico and then in detail into the crafting of chocolate, with steps illustrated by samples to taste. Vegans catered for with dairy and gelatin-free samples and also in making your own chocolate lolly. Highly recommended for an in-depth cocoa treat.

My son and I had Sarah Walker as our tour guide. Sarah was a very friendly, animated, caring and attentive tour guide. I informed Sarah that, as my son and I are Muslims, we were unable to have any chocolates that had alcohol, porcine based gelatine, or any other non-halal animal based gelatine in it. Sarah very conscientiously made sure that all the chocolates that were offered to me and my son were halal. She frequently checked the contents information sheet, to make sure that the type of chocolate that I and my son chose were halal. I applaud York Chocolate Story, in preparing a contents information sheet, which states which chocolate is halal, and which ones are not. Thank you Sarah, for making me and my son feel included, and reassured that what we were eating was halal. And thank you Sarah, and York Chocolate Story, for making us feel welcomed, included, and cared for during the tour. I would recommend going for the York Chocolate Story tour for anyone who loves chocolates, and I would definitely recommend Muslims to go and experience the tour.
